Genome sequencing technology, including the 30x whole genome sequencing that’s part of our Ultimate Genome Sequencing service, generates data files in bam and fastq formats. Since these files provide your full genome, they are massive in size. Each file is usually more than 35 GB in size!

De novo sequencing refers to sequencing of a novel genome without reference sequence available. The coverage quality of de novo assembly depends on the size and continuity of the contigs. Se hela listan på publichealthmatters.blog.gov.uk This bacterial genome was sequenced in 1995, using shotgun sequencing whereby you randomly sequence short fragments of the genome and then reassemble using bioinformatics tools . When the Human Genome Project sequenced the first human genome in 2001, shotgun sequencing was also used, but, since the human genome is so much larger than a bacterial genome, the human genome was not fully sequenced.

Genome sequencing is an important step toward correlating genotypes with phenotypic characters. Sequencing technologies are important in many fields in the life sciences, including functional genomics, transcriptomics, oncology, evolutionary biology, forensic sciences, and many more. The era of sequencing has been divided into three generations.
